Data Analyst Salary in Opelika, AL: $58,294 (2026)

Quick Answer:A full-time data analyst in Opelika, AL earns a median $58,294/year (≈ $28.02/hour) in nominal terms for 2026 — proj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 15-2051). Once you factor in Opelika's price level (12% below national, BEA RPP 87.9), that paycheck buys what $66,319 would nationally. Nominal pay sits 3.4% below the Alabama state average.

Adjusted salary = nominal × (100 / CoL index). CoL index: 100 = national average.

The nominal salary is $58,294. After adjusting for a cost-of-living index of 87.9, the purchasing-power equivalent is $66,319, a gain of $8,025.$49.5K$60.3K$71.0K$81.7K$92.5K$58,294NominalSalary$66,319CoL Adjusted(CoL: 87.9) 13.77%US Median $80.4K

Opelika, AL has a cost-of-living index of 87.9 (below the national average of 100). A data analyst earning $58,294 nominally has purchasing power equivalent to $66,319 in an average-cost city — an effective 13.77% boost.

Based on 5 years of BLS OEWS data for the Opelika metropolitan area, the median data analyst salary grew 19.1% from $46,828 (2021) to $55,794 (2025). At a 4.48% compound annual growth rate, salaries are projected to reach $60,905 by 2027 — a total increase of $14,077 (30.06%) from 2021.

Note: Historical values (20212025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the Opelika met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 20262026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 4.48% CAGR derived from 5-year BLS historical data.
